This document provides an overview of Odoo's vision, strategy, and challenges for 2019. Some key points:
- Odoo has 4.8 million happy users, 20,000 community modules, and is the #1 business app store. It has 700 employees.
- Odoo uses a dual business model with both a community (open source) and enterprise version, and revenue from the enterprise helps invest in the community.
- Odoo has experienced hypergrowth, growing from 1 employee in 2004 to over 850 employees by the end of 2019.
